Is the Boston Tea Party a true story?

Definitely true. It was a significant protest by colonists against British rule and taxation policies. This event had a major impact on the lead-up to the American Revolution.

The Boston Tea Party is indeed a factual occurrence. It was a bold statement made by the colonists to oppose British oppression and unfair trade practices. This act became a symbol of resistance and played a crucial role in shaping American history.

Yes, it is. The Boston Tea Party was a real historical event that took place in Boston in 1773.

What was the real story of the Boston Tea Party?

The Boston Tea Party was a protest by American colonists against British rule. Fed up with the Tea Act which gave a monopoly to the British East India Company, colonists dressed as Native Americans and dumped tea into Boston Harbor in 1773. This was a significant act of defiance that was part of the build - up to the American Revolution.
